how many molecules and atoms of phosphorus are present in 0.1 mole of P4 molecules
Answers & Comments
anustarnoorYou know that in 1 mole of p4 there are 4 moles of p Similarly in .1 moles of p4 there are .4 moles of p So number of atoms = 4/10*6*10^23 Therefore number of atoms = 2.4*10^23
